Overview Lori 5mg Injection

Medrol 5mg Injection, a prescription medication, effectively manages short-term anxiety. Its applications extend to acute alcohol withdrawal symptom relief, muscle spasm reduction, and as supplemental seizure treatment. This injectable medication works by calming the central nervous system. Administration is strictly limited to healthcare professionals; self-injection is prohibited. Dosage and treatment length are determined by your physician based on individual needs. Consistent adherence to the prescribed injection schedule optimizes therapeutic outcomes. Commonly reported side effects include drowsiness, fatigue, confusion, and potential withdrawal reactions. Any persistent or worsening side effects warrant immediate medical attention. Avoid activities requiring alertness until the drug's impact is fully assessed. Weight gain is a possible consequence; maintaining a healthy diet and exercise routine can help mitigate this. Prolonged use may necessitate routine blood and liver function monitoring.

How Lori 5mg Injection works:

Lori 5mg Injection, a benzodiazepine, enhances the effects of GABA, a neurotransmitter, thereby reducing heightened and irregular neuronal firing in the brain.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Avoid alcohol consumption while using Lori 5mg Injection.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Administering Lori 5mg Injection during pregnancy is contraindicated due to confirmed risk to the fetus. In exceptional, life-threatening circumstances, a physician might prescribe it if the potential benefits outweigh the known hazards. Physician consultation is essential.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Administration of Lori 5mg Injection while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ates a potential for the medication to trans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Administering Lori 5mg Injection may induce adverse reactions that impair driving capabilities. Drowsiness, memory lapses, and reduced coordination are potential effects of Lori 5mg Injection, potentially affecting driving safety.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Caution is advised when administering Lori 5mg Injection to individuals with impaired kidney function. The dosage of Lori 5mg Injection might require modification. Physician consultation is recommended. Dosage alterations may be necessary for extended treatment durations.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Individuals with hepatic impairment should use Lori 5mg Injection cautiously; d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Lori 5mg Injection :

Should you forget a Lori 5mg Injection,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Lori 5mg Injection

Lori 5mg Injection, a benzodiazepine, isn't an antidepressant. It treats severe anxiety (characterized by sweating, trembling, anxiety, and rapid heartbeat), agitation, muscle spasms from tetanus or poisoning, seizures, confusion, alcohol withdrawal anxiety, and helps relax patients before minor procedures.
The effects of Lori 5mg Injection depend on its purpose. For anxiety, noticeable improvement may occur within hours, though complete benefits might take one to two weeks. For muscle spasms, relief can begin within 15 minutes, with continued relaxation resulting from regular use over several days.
Lori 5mg Injection frequently causes drowsiness, forgetfulness, and impaired muscle function, potentially impacting your ability to drive safely. This drowsiness can sometimes linger into the next day. Therefore, avoid driving if you experience sleepiness or reduced alertness after receiving this injection.
Combining Lori 5mg Injection with alcohol is strongly discouraged. This combination can cause respiratory depression, excessive drowsiness, and cardiac issues, potentially leading to fatal consequences due to severely impaired breathing.
Prolonged or high-dose use of Lori 5mg Injection can lead to addiction, particularly in individuals with a history of substance abuse. To minimize this risk, use should be limited to the shortest duration and lowest effective dosage.
Abruptly stopping Lori 5mg Injection can cause withdrawal symptoms including depression, anxiety, insomnia, irritability, sweating, gastrointestinal upset, and mood changes. These effects, potentially including a return and worsening of original symptoms, can occur even after short-term, low-dose use. Do not discontinue this medication without consulting your doctor.
Lori 5mg Injection treatment is typically short, aiming for the shortest effective duration. Your doctor will review your progress after four weeks to determine if continued treatment is necessary, particularly if symptoms are absent. Treatment rarely exceeds 8-12 weeks, encompassing a gradual dose reduction.
Lori 5mg Injection doesn't interfere with any form of contraception, including birth control pills and emergency contraception. Birth control pills may prolong Lori 5mg Injection's presence and effects in your body, potentially causing intermenstrual bleeding. However, your contraception remains effective.
Combining clozapine and Lori 5mg Injection is strongly discouraged due to the potential for additive effects. This combination may cause dangerously low blood pressure, respiratory difficulties, and even cardiac arrest, potentially resulting in death.
Elderly patients typically require half the standard adult dose of Lori 5mg Injection. This reduced dosage is due to the drug's muscle relaxant effect, which increases the risk of falls and subsequent fractures.
